Transaction 5c26588b64bdab8cce21f8ee5c50d9aad8b7906e4673f3b700318d4ee3844772

2 Input
2 Outputs
  • 5c26588b64bdab8cce21f8ee5c50d9aad8b7906e4673f3b700318d4ee3844772:0
  • value  594027
    address  1Bbk2r3E4F53p2fNsAH42SpMWcPtaxFaP4
  • 5c26588b64bdab8cce21f8ee5c50d9aad8b7906e4673f3b700318d4ee3844772:1
  • value  2915
    address  1EcWWvnqZ7xsV3bRiBrcnU43fAu3oafaM6